Florida Secondary Water Barrier: Code, Installation, and What You Need to Know

Yes, Florida requires a secondary water barrier (SWR) for most residential re-roofs. Under 2023 Florida Building Code section R908.7.2, whenever a roof covering is removed and replaced on a structure with a wood roof deck, a secondary water barrier must be installed in accordance with R905.1.1 or Section 1518.x. There is no grandfathering. If your contractor strips the deck, the current code applies.
A few exceptions exist, and they matter:
- Roof slopes under 2:12 where a continuous roof system is installed
- Clay or concrete tile assemblies installed per code that are deemed compliant
- HVHZ (High Velocity Hurricane Zone) projects, which follow stricter sealed-deck rules rather than the base SWR requirement

What is a secondary water barrier and why does it matter for Florida roofs?
A secondary water barrier is a layer of protection installed directly on the wood roof deck, underneath the primary roof covering. Its job is simple: if your shingles, tiles, or metal panels are torn off in a hurricane, the SWR keeps water out of your home until repairs can be made.
The most effective form is a sealed roof deck, created by bonding a self-adhering polymer-modified bitumen underlayment (commonly called peel-and-stick) directly to the deck surface. This creates a continuous waterproof membrane with no gaps. Post-hurricane performance data shows that sealed decks reduce interior water damage significantly when primary coverings are lost, which is exactly why Florida adopted these requirements after major storm seasons.
Here’s how the three layers differ in practice:
- Primary roof covering: Your shingles, tile, or metal panels. First line of defense, but vulnerable to high winds.
- Standard underlayment: Traditional 15# or 30# felt, or a basic synthetic. Provides some moisture resistance but is not a sealed system.
- Secondary water barrier / sealed deck: A fully adhered peel-and-stick membrane bonded to the deck. No seams, no gaps, no reliance on fasteners alone.
The distinction between a full sealed deck and a limited joint-sealing method is worth understanding. Full-deck peel-and-stick covers every square inch of the deck. Joint-sealing methods use self-adhering bitumen tape over panel seams only. Both can satisfy the code requirement depending on your location and roof type, but they are not interchangeable in all situations.
Does the Florida Building Code require a secondary water barrier on your roof?
The short answer: yes, for most re-roofs on wood-deck homes. R908.7.2 of the 2023 Florida Building Code is the governing section for existing structures. It triggers the SWR requirement the moment a roof covering is removed and replaced, pointing to R905.1.1 and Section 1518.x for the specific installation standards.
🚨 No grandfathering: A re-roof that exposes the deck sheathing triggers current sealed-deck requirements, regardless of when the home was built. This is confirmed in UpCodes’ summary of R908.7.2.
Geographic triggers make a real difference:
- Wind-Borne Debris Region (WBDR): Most of Florida falls here. Sealed-deck provisions apply to specific roof coverings under R905.1.1.
- High Velocity Hurricane Zone (HVHZ): Miami-Dade and Broward counties. Stricter requirements, NOA-approved products required, and sealed-deck expectations go beyond the base FBC text.
- Outside WBDR: Some inland areas. Base SWR requirements still apply per R908.7.2, but product standards may be slightly less restrictive.
Common exceptions to know:
- Roof slopes under 2:12 with a continuous roof system (such as TPO or modified bitumen) installed per code
- Clay and concrete tile systems installed per the applicable FBC tile section, which may satisfy the requirement through the tile assembly itself
- Certain re-cover situations where the deck is not exposed (though full tear-offs almost always trigger the requirement)
A complete re-roof down to the deck leaves no room for debate. The SWR requirement applies.
What installation methods does Florida code actually accept?
UpCodes’ compilation of R908.7.2 outlines two primary code-accepted approaches, and the one your contractor uses depends on your location and roof type.
Accepted SWR installation methods:
- Full-deck self-adhering polymer-modified bitumen underlayment (peel-and-stick): Meets ASTM D1970. Bonded directly to the entire deck surface. This is the sealed-deck approach and the most protective option.
- Joint-sealing with self-adhering bitumen tape: A minimum 4-inch-wide self-adhering bitumen tape applied over all panel joints, covered by an approved underlayment system. Acceptable in specific situations outside HVHZ.
- 30# asphalt felt or approved synthetic underlayment: Permitted in certain configurations where the code allows, though synthetic underlayments are often preferred in Florida’s climate due to better UV and moisture resistance.
Key installation details inspectors look for:
- Minimum 4-inch side laps and 6-inch end laps on peel-and-stick products
- Full adhesion with no bubbles, lifted edges, or unbonded sections
- All penetrations (pipes, vents, skylights) sealed with compatible flashing and sealant
- Deck surface clean, dry, and free of debris before membrane application
In the HVHZ, base FBC text is not enough. Products must carry a Miami-Dade Notice of Acceptance (NOA) or Florida Product Approval, and installation must follow the NOA’s specific requirements. A product that is code-compliant in Tampa may not be acceptable in Miami without that NOA documentation.
Pro Tip: Take photos at every stage: bare deck condition, membrane unrolled, laps sealed, and penetrations detailed. These photos are your proof of compliance for the permit inspection and your insurer.
When do the exceptions apply? Tiles, low slopes, and HVHZ details
Not every Florida roof triggers the full peel-and-stick requirement. Here’s where the exceptions actually apply and where homeowners sometimes get tripped up.

Clay and concrete tile systems: Properly installed tile assemblies can satisfy the SWR requirement through the tile system itself, provided the installation follows the applicable FBC tile section. The key word is “properly installed.” If the tile system doesn’t meet code on its own, the standard SWR requirement kicks back in. Roof slopes under 2:12: Low-slope roofs with a continuous roof system, such as TPO, modified bitumen, or similar membrane systems, may satisfy the requirement without a separate peel-and-stick layer. The continuous system itself acts as the waterproof barrier. This is why TPO flat roofing is a common solution for low-slope commercial and residential applications in Florida.
HVHZ (Miami-Dade and Broward): These counties go beyond the base FBC. Sealed-deck requirements in the HVHZ demand NOA-approved products and stricter installation standards. Local inspectors in Miami-Dade and Broward will verify NOA numbers on product packaging and may reject materials that lack proper approval documentation.
The most common misapplication: Contractors applying joint-tape only when the code or local jurisdiction requires full-deck coverage. Partial coverage where full coverage is required fails inspection and leaves your home exposed. Confirm with your contractor and local building department which method is required for your specific address and roof type.
How does a sealed roof deck affect your wind mitigation inspection and insurance?
A properly documented sealed roof deck can factor into your wind mitigation inspection and may influence your homeowner’s insurance premium. Florida’s wind mitigation form asks about roof deck attachment and roof covering, and a sealed deck is a recognized mitigation feature that insurers evaluate.
Sealed decks reduce interior water damage when primary coverings are stripped in high-wind events, which is the core reason insurers and wind mitigation inspectors take them seriously. The My Safe Florida Home program also references wind mitigation improvements as a path to potential insurance credits.
What your insurer typically wants to see:
- Product data sheets showing ASTM D1970 compliance or equivalent
- Manufacturer certifications and NOA (if in HVHZ)
- Building permit with the SWR line item included
- Final inspection sign-off from the building department
- Installation photos showing full adhesion and sealed penetrations
Action steps before and after installation:
- Call your insurance agent before the re-roof begins and ask what documentation they need for a wind mitigation credit.
- Confirm your contractor will pull a permit that specifically lists the secondary water barrier.
- Request a copy of the product data sheet before installation starts.
- Schedule a wind mitigation inspection after the final permit sign-off.
- Submit the completed wind mitigation form to your insurer with all supporting photos and documentation.

📋 Permit, inspection, and documentation checklist for SWR work
Getting the SWR installed correctly is step one. Documenting it properly is what protects you with your insurer and the building department.
Permit and inspection items:
- Building permit pulled before work begins, with secondary water barrier listed as a line item
- Inspector access during installation (not just at final)
- Final certificate of compliance or inspection sign-off from the local building department
Documentation to collect from your contractor:
- Product data sheets for the SWR membrane (confirm ASTM D1970 or the applicable approval)
- NOA documentation if the project is in HVHZ
- Installation photos: bare deck, membrane applied, laps sealed, penetrations detailed
- Copy of contractor’s Florida license number
- Manufacturer warranty documentation
Common documentation mistakes that cost homeowners:
- No permit pulled (contractor skips it to save time; you lose insurance credit and face code violations)
- Generic product name on paperwork with no ASTM number or approval reference
- Photos taken only at the end, not during installation (can’t prove laps were sealed)
- Missing penetration sealing photos (inspectors and insurers specifically look for this)

How to choose a contractor who actually knows secondary water barrier requirements
Most homeowners don’t know enough to quiz a contractor on SWR specifics, which is exactly how substandard work gets installed. These questions will tell you quickly whether a contractor knows what they’re doing.
Credentials to verify first:
- Active Florida contractor license (check the Florida DBPR license lookup)
- GAF Master Elite® or equivalent manufacturer certification
- General liability insurance and workers’ compensation coverage
- BBB Accreditation
Essential questions to ask before signing:
- Will you install a full sealed deck (peel-and-stick over the entire deck) or only taped joints?
- What specific product will you use, and what is its ASTM number or Florida Product Approval?
- Who pulls the permit, and will the SWR be listed as a line item?
- Can you provide product data sheets and installation photos before and after?
- Have you installed SWR systems in HVHZ, and do you know the NOA requirements for my county?
Red flags that should stop you cold:
- Contractor says a permit isn’t necessary or offers to skip it
- Vague product names (“we use good peel-and-stick”) with no ASTM reference
- No clear answer on who handles the inspection
- Refuses to provide documentation or photos after the job

Here’s how a typical SWR installation runs on a Tampa Bay re-roof:
- Deck inspection first: Before any membrane goes down, the crew inspects the deck for soft spots, rot, and fastener pull-through. Damaged decking is replaced before the SWR is applied.
- Surface prep: The deck is swept clean and allowed to dry. In Tampa Bay’s humidity, this step gets extra attention because moisture trapped under peel-and-stick causes adhesion failure.
- Full-deck membrane application: Hytzroofing uses manufacturer-approved, ASTM D1970-compliant self-adhering polymer-modified bitumen underlayment. Rolls are applied with minimum 4-inch side laps and 6-inch end laps, with all laps rolled and pressed for full adhesion.
- Penetration detailing: Every pipe, vent, and skylight gets flashed and sealed with compatible materials before the primary covering goes on.
- Photo documentation: The crew photographs the bare deck, membrane application, lap sealing, and all penetrations. These go directly into the project file for the permit inspection and insurance documentation.
Local Tampa Bay considerations:
- Salt air near the coast can affect adhesion on certain membrane products; Hytzroofing specifies products rated for coastal exposure.
- Florida’s UV intensity degrades exposed peel-and-stick quickly. Shingle or tile installation follows the membrane within the manufacturer’s recommended window, typically within 30–60 days depending on the product.

FAQ
Is a secondary water barrier required in Florida?
Yes. Under 2023 FBC R908.7.2, a secondary water barrier is required on most residential re-roofs where the roof covering is removed and replaced on a wood deck. Exceptions apply for certain low-slope continuous systems and properly installed tile assemblies.
What is a secondary water barrier?
A secondary water barrier is a waterproof layer, typically a self-adhering polymer-modified bitumen (peel-and-stick) membrane, bonded directly to the roof deck beneath the primary covering. It protects the home’s interior if the primary roof covering is lost in a hurricane or high-wind event.
What is the 25% roof rule in Florida?
Florida’s roof rule generally refers to the threshold at which a re-roof triggers full code compliance: if a significant portion of a roof covering is replaced within a 12-month period, the entire roof must be brought up to current code, including secondary water barrier requirements. Confirm the specific threshold with your local building department, as enforcement details can vary by jurisdiction.
What is the best underlayment for a roof in Florida?
For most Florida re-roofs, a self-adhering polymer-modified bitumen underlayment (ASTM D1970 peel-and-stick) is the strongest choice because it creates a sealed deck. Where a fully adhered membrane is not required, approved synthetic underlayments are often preferred over 30# felt due to better UV resistance and moisture performance in Florida’s heat and humidity.
